SpaceX is scheduled to launch a Falcon 9 rocket from Cape Canaveral Wednesday with 54 extra Starlink web satellites, a mission that may start populating a brand new orbital shell approved by federal regulators earlier this month for the corporate’s Starlink Gen2 community.
Liftoff of the Falcon 9 rocket from pad 40 at Cape Canaveral House Pressure Station on SpaceX’s Starlink 5-1 mission is about for 4:40 a.m. EST (0940 GMT) Wednesday. The mission will likely be SpaceX’s sixtieth launch of the yr, with yet another Falcon 9 flight set to blast off later this week from Vandenberg House Pressure Base, California, with an Israeli Earth-imaging satellite tv for pc.
There’s a higher than 90% likelihood of favorable climate for launch Wednesday, based on the U.S. House Pressure’s forty fifth Climate Squadron at Cape Canaveral.
The 54 satellites launching Wednesday would be the first spacecraft deployed into a brand new section of the Starlink constellation. The Falcon 9 rocket will goal to launch the 54 satellites at an orbital altitude and inclination put aside to be used by SpaceX’s second-generation Starlink community, which the corporate finally intends to launch on the brand new Starship mega-rocket.
SpaceX is growing a a lot bigger, higher-power Starlink satellite tv for pc platform succesful transmitting alerts on to cell telephones. However with the Starship’s first orbital take a look at flight nonetheless on maintain, SpaceX officers have signaled they’ll begin launching the Gen2 satellites on Falcon 9 rockets. Elon Musk, SpaceX’s founder and CEO, prompt in August that the corporate might develop a miniature model of the Gen2 satellites to suit on the Falcon 9 rocket.
SpaceX has revealed little details about the Starlink 5-1 mission set to take off Wednesday. It’s unclear whether or not SpaceX will use the satellites to check out new {hardware} or software program for use on the Gen2 community.
However the circumstances of the flight counsel the Starlink satellites on-board the Falcon 9 rocket are comparable in dimension to SpaceX’s present Starlink spacecraft, and never the bigger Gen2 satellites destined to fly on the large new Starship rocket, and even the mini Gen2 satellites Musk talked about earlier this yr. There are 54 satellites on the Falcon 9 launcher set to fly Wednesday, the identical quantity SpaceX has launched on many latest Starlink missions.

The Federal Communications Fee granted SpaceX approval Dec. 1 to launch as much as 7,500 of its deliberate 29,988-spacecraft Starlink Gen2 constellation. The regulatory company deferred a choice on the remaining satellites SpaceX proposed for Gen2.
The FCC beforehand approved SpaceX to launch and function as much as 12,000 Starlink satellites, together with roughly 4,400 first-generation Ka-band and Ku-band Starlink spacecraft that SpaceX has been launching since 2019. SpaceX additionally obtained regulatory approval to launch greater than 7,500 Starlink satellites working in a special V-band frequency.
SpaceX informed the FCC earlier this yr it deliberate to consolidate the V-band Starlink fleet into the bigger Gen2 constellation.
The Gen2 satellites might enhance Starlink protection over decrease latitude areas, and assist alleviate stress on the community from rising client uptake. SpaceX mentioned earlier this month the community now has greater than 1 million lively subscribers. The Starlink spacecraft beam broadband web alerts to shoppers around the globe, connectivity that’s now obtainable on all seven continents with testing underway at a analysis station in Antarctica.
“Our motion will enable SpaceX to start deployment of Gen2 Starlink, which can convey subsequent technology satellite tv for pc broadband to People nationwide, together with these dwelling and dealing in areas historically unserved or underserved by terrestrial techniques,” the FCC wrote in its Dec. 1 order partially approving the Starlink Gen2 constellation. “Our motion additionally will allow worldwide satellite tv for pc broadband service, serving to to shut the digital divide on a worldwide scale.
“On the identical time, this restricted grant and related situations will shield different satellite tv for pc and terrestrial operators from dangerous interference and preserve a protected house atmosphere, selling competitors and defending spectrum and orbital assets for future use,” the FCC wrote. “We defer motion on the rest of SpaceX’s utility presently.”
Particularly, the FCC granted SpaceX authority to launch the preliminary block of seven,500 Starlink Gen2 satellites into orbits at 525, 530, and 535 kilometers, with inclinations of 53, 43, and 33 levels, respectively, utilizing Ku-band and Ka-band frequencies. The FCC deferred a choice on SpaceX’s request to function Starlink Gen2 satellites in increased and decrease orbits.
The Starlink 5-1 mission set to fly Wednesday will goal the 530-kilometer-high (329-mile) orbit at an inclination of 43 levels to the equator.

Going into Wednesday’s mission, SpaceX has launched 3,612 Starlink satellites on greater than 60 Falcon 9 rocket missions, together with prototypes and failed spacecraft. The corporate presently has greater than 3,200 functioning Starlink satellites in house, with about 3,000 operational and almost 200 shifting into their operational orbits, according to a tabulation by Jonathan McDowell, an skilled tracker of spaceflight exercise and an astronomer on the Harvard-Smithsonian Middle for Astrophysics.
The primary-generation Starlink community structure consists of satellites flying a couple of hundred miles up, orbiting at inclinations of 97.6 levels, 70 levels, 53.2 levels, and 53.0 levels to the equator. Most of SpaceX’s latest Starlink launches have launched satellites into Shell 4, at an inclination of 53.2 levels, after the corporate largely accomplished launches into the primary 53-degree inclination shell final yr.
Shell 5 of the Starlink community was extensively believed to be one of many polar-orbiting layers of the constellation, at 97.6 levels inclination. However the identify of Wednesday’s mission — Starlink 5-1 — may counsel SpaceX has modified the naming scheme for the Starlink shells.
SpaceX’s launch staff will likely be stationed inside a launch management middle simply south of Cape Canaveral House Pressure Station for Wednesday’s predawn countdown. SpaceX will staff will start loading super-chilled, densified kerosene and liquid oxygen propellants into the Falcon 9 car at T-minus 35 minutes.
Helium pressurant will even stream into the rocket within the final half-hour of the countdown. Within the remaining seven minutes earlier than liftoff, the Falcon 9’s Merlin essential engines will likely be thermally conditioned for flight by a process referred to as “chilldown.” The Falcon 9’s steerage and vary security techniques will even be additionally configured for launch.
After liftoff, the Falcon 9 rocket will vector its 1.7 million kilos of thrust — produced by 9 Merlin engines — to steer southeast over the Atlantic Ocean. The launch marks the resumption of Starlink missions from Cape Canaveral utilizing the southeasterly launch hall, as SpaceX did final winter to reap the benefits of higher sea situations for touchdown of the Falcon 9’s first stage booster.
All through the summer season and fall, SpaceX launched Starlink missions on paths towards the northeast from Florida’s House Coast.
The Falcon 9 rocket will exceed the velocity of sound in about one minute, then shut down its 9 essential engines two-and-a-half minutes after liftoff. The booster stage will launch from the Falcon 9’s higher stage, then fireplace pulses from chilly gasoline management thrusters and prolonged titanium grid fins to assist steer the car again into the environment.
Two braking burns will gradual the rocket for touchdown on the drone ship “A Shortfall of Gravitas” round 410 miles (660 kilometers) downrange roughly 9 minutes after liftoff.
The Falcon 9’s reusable payload fairing will jettison in the course of the second stage burn. A restoration ship can also be on station within the Atlantic to retrieve the 2 halves of the nostril cone after they splash down beneath parachutes.
Touchdown of the primary stage on Saturday’s mission will happen moments after the Falcon 9’s second stage engine cuts off to ship the Starlink satellites into orbit. Separation of the 54 Starlink spacecraft, constructed by SpaceX in Redmond, Washington, from the Falcon 9 rocket is anticipated round quarter-hour after liftoff.
The Falcon 9’s steerage laptop goals to deploy the satellites into an elliptical orbit at an inclination of 43 levels to the equator, with an altitude ranging between 131 miles and 210 miles (212-by-338 kilometers). After separating from the rocket, the 54 Starlink spacecraft will unfurl photo voltaic arrays and run by automated activation steps, then use ion engines to maneuver into their operational orbit.
